From: Yinghai Lu <yinghai@kernel.org>
parse_elf is using local memcpy to move section to running position.
That memcpy actually only support no overlapping case or when dest < src.
Add checking in memcpy to find out the wrong case for future use, at
that time we will need to have backward memcpy for it.

+extern void error(char *x);
+void *memcpy(void *dest, const void *src, size_t n)
+{
+ unsigned long start_dest, end_dest;
+ unsigned long start_src, end_src;
+ unsigned long max_start, min_end;
+
+ if (dest < src)
+ return __memcpy(dest, src, n);
+
+ start_dest = (unsigned long)dest;
+ end_dest = (unsigned long)dest + n;
+ start_src = (unsigned long)src;
+ end_src = (unsigned long)src + n;
+ max_start = (start_dest > start_src) ? start_dest : start_src;
+ min_end = (end_dest < end_src) ? end_dest : end_src;
+
+ if (max_start >= min_end)
+ return __memcpy(dest, src, n);
+
+ error("memcpy does not support overlapping with dest > src!\n");
+
+ return dest;
+}
